river play vs 2p2er, again.
online 5/10, 4handed game.
whitelime opens, button and sb fold, i(1K) call in BB w/ K [img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img]Q [img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img] flop J [img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img]4 [img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img]T [img]/images/graemlins/club.gif[/img](75) check, 60, i call. turn 6 [img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img](195) i bet 175, whitelime calls. river K [img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img](545) i check, whitelime bets 300, i only have 725 total left but i really wanna push. do it? |

Re: river play vs 2p2er, again.
[ QUOTE ]
one more Q, should i push the river here the first time i act? [/ QUOTE ] maybe, i just think that he would have a flush here a lot of the time. He might also have AsJ or a set or two pair which you can push him off of i guess. Depends a lot on how he views you. The more often you believe he raises the turn w a flush, the better the play becomes. |
